OH2 Ornamental Herbicide, manufactured by ICL Specialty Fertilizers, is a cost-efficient and effective pre-emergent herbicide of weeds in container and field grown ornamentals without leaving behind high levels of dust residue.
Combines two selective herbicides into one granule, giving professionals nursery owners a wider range of control against weeds like oxalis and better ornamental tolerance to product usage.
OH2 Ornamental Herbicide great combination of ingredients provides season-long control against hard to control weeds with a single application, helping to minimize consistent applications and reduce overall labor.
Tools Needed
Apply OH2 Ornamental Herbicide with a properly calibrated rotary spreader that will assure accurate, even particle distribution. Product can also be applied by aerial equipment.
How to Use
- Step 1: Before each OH2 Ornamental Herbicide application, remove any existing weeds with a post-emergent herbicide. Determine how much OH2 Ornamental Herbicide to use by measuring the square footage of the treatment area. To do this, measure the length and width of the treatment area in feet then multiply them together (length X width = square footage). For acreage, take the square footage and divide it by one acre (square footage / 43,560 sq. ft. = acres). For individual ornamental container applications the rates will vary based on container size and surface area. To treat 1 gallon containers (6” diam.) with a 0.20 sq. ft. surface area use 1/8 tsp. of OH2 Ornamental Herbicide. For 2 gallon (9” diam.) containers with 0.44 sq. ft. surface area use 1/4 tsp of product. For 3 gallon containers (10" diam.) with a 0.55 sq. ft. surface area use 1/4 tsp. of product. For 5 gallon containers (12" diam.) with 0.79 sq. ft. surface area use 1/4 tsp. of product. For 15 gallon containers (17" diam.) with 1.60 sq. ft. surface area use 1/2 tsp. of product. For field grown ornamentals, apply 2.3 lbs. of product per 1,000 sq. ft.
- Step 2: Load the measured amount of OH2 Ornamental Herbicide into the properly calibrated spreader.
- Step 3: Spread the OH2 Ornamental Herbicide across dry foliage as an over the top or soil directed application. Water in with 1/2-1 inches of irrigation immediately after application to wash the particles off the plant foliage and to activate the herbicide.
Where to Use
Apply OH2 Ornamental Herbicide to dry foliage or soil within container and field grown ornamentals in nurseries and landscape ornamentals.
Not for use on vegetables, bedding plants, liner production beds, flowers, ground covers, vegetables, and turf.
Do not incorporate product into soil or potting media nor apply product directly to bare roots.
When to Use
OH2 Ornamental Herbicide may be applied when plants are well established, dry, and there are no emerged weeds and when temperatures are above 35 degrees Fahrenheit.
Do not apply while plants are producing a new flush of spring growth. Tender, newly forming leaves are especially sensitive and may be injured by the herbicide. Do not use on fruit trees that will bear fruit within one year of application.
Safety Information
OH2 Ornamental Herbicide is safe to use around children and pets when applied according to the product label instructions. Always wear the proper personal protective equipment (PPE) when applying this product.
Do not allow people or pets to enter treated areas until 24 hours have passed after application.
Special Considerations
Do not apply OH2 Ornamental Herbicide in enclosed greenhouse or polyhouse structures as ornamental injury may result. Product should not be applied within two (2) weeks prior to enclosure in greenhouse type structure or within two (2) weeks prior to shipping.
This product should not be applied to plant types whose leaves channel the herbicide granules to the leaf base (such as Yucca spp. and Dracaena spp.).
